Enter your dates for the latest hotel rates and availability.
1,323 hotels
969 hotels
1,741 hotels
432 hotels
1,627 hotels
305 hotels
195 hotels
169 hotels
184 hotels
180 hotels
877 hotels
797 hotels
953 hotels
337 hotels
64 hotels
74 hotels
780 hotels
921 hotels
457 hotels
963 hotels
33,347 hotels
7,610 hotels
6,551 hotels
15,564 hotels
19,520 hotels
23,344 hotels
7,121 hotels
12,681 hotels
11,512 hotels